I have been doing more and more builds lately, and i want a testbench, but I don't want an expensive one, so which options do i have sub 100$?

These are the three I could find, but they cost more like 150$

 

Lian Li PC-T60B Aerocool Strike-X Air

and 

Cooler Master Test Bench V1.0

Which would you choose, and why?

I would go with the coolermaster. It's clean it's basic, it looks very well thought out with features to make getting parts on and off very easy. The Lian Li looks a bit trickier but would keep the components more locked in. and the aerocool just looks like a headache.
